What is Com Que Voz (2011) about?
This documentary explores the life and legacy of Alain Oulman, a cultural icon of the 1960s and 1970s who left an indelible mark on Portuguese and French society.
Who directed Com Que Voz?
Com Que Voz (2011) was directed by Nicholas Oulman.
Who stars in Com Que Voz?
The film features a talented cast, including Nuno Vieira de Almeida, Camané, and João Perry.

How long is Com Que Voz?
The runtime of Com Que Voz (2011) is 108 minutes.
About Com Que Voz (2011) — A Cultural Icon's Enduring Impact
Delve into the captivating world of Com Que Voz (2011), a poignant documentary that explores the life of Alain Oulman, a cultural icon of the 1960s and 1970s. Director Nicholas Oulman masterfully weaves together the threads of Oulman's impact on Portuguese and French society, featuring an array of esteemed guests, including Patricia Highsmith and Mario Soares. Shot in three continents, this film is a rich tapestry of stories, politics, and music, offering a glimpse into a bygone era. From the vibrant streets of Lisbon to the intellectual hubs of Paris and Tel Aviv, Com Que Voz (2011) is a thought-provoking journey that will leave viewers enchanted and informed.
